Tax Planning with a Financial Advisor in Turkey

One of the most critical services offered by a financial advisor in Turkey is tax planning. The Turkish tax system can be challenging to navigate for foreign investors, with various taxes such as corporate tax, VAT, and income tax to consider. A financial advisor helps ensure you are fully compliant with tax laws while minimizing your liabilities through strategic planning.

Important Tax Considerations for Foreign Investors:

  • Corporate Tax: Foreign companies investing in Turkey are subject to corporate income tax. However, there are tax incentives and exemptions available, especially for companies involved in specific industries like energy or technology.
  • Value Added Tax (VAT): VAT is a significant consideration for businesses operating in Turkey. A financial advisor ensures that your VAT returns are accurate and submitted on time to avoid penalties.
  • Withholding Tax: Depending on your business structure, you may also be liable for withholding tax on dividends, interest, and royalties. A financial advisor ensures you are aware of all withholding tax obligations.
  • Double Taxation Agreements: Turkey has double taxation agreements with many countries, which can help foreign investors avoid being taxed twice. A financial advisor ensures you benefit from these agreements, reducing your overall tax burden.

Risk Management Strategies for Foreign Investors

Foreign investors in Turkey face a range of risks, from currency fluctuations to political instability. A financial advisor in Turkey helps identify and manage these risks to protect your investments and ensure long-term success.

Key Risk Management Strategies:

  • Currency Hedging: The Turkish Lira can be volatile. A financial advisor can help implement currency hedging strategies to protect against exchange rate fluctuations.
  • Diversification: Spreading your investments across different sectors can minimize the risk of financial loss. A financial advisor will work with you to build a diversified portfolio.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Failure to comply with Turkish financial regulations can result in fines and penalties. A financial advisor ensures that your business operations are fully compliant, reducing legal risks.
